Choosing a Bookmaker: What to Look For

Selecting the ufc betting right bookmaker can be a tricky endeavor , and it's vital to do your homework before putting money down. Evaluate several factors to ensure you’re selecting a reliable service . Here's what to keep in mind :

  • Permits – Verify that the site holds a proper authorization from a respected governing authority .
  • Odds & Payouts – Contrast the payouts available from different platforms. Higher prices will noticeably impact your winnings .
  • Welcome Bonuses – Explore welcome bonuses , but understand the terms and conditions linked to them.
  • Deposit Methods – Ensure the platform offers convenient deposit methods that work for you .
  • Customer Support – Look for efficient user service , optimally around the clock via multiple channels such as live support .

Keep in mind to bet within your limits and set a budget before you place your bets.

    Understanding Sports Betting Odds: A Breakdown

    Navigating the landscape of sports gambling can feel confusing , especially when it comes to deciphering odds. Basically, betting odds show the chance of a specific outcome occurring and translate that into a projected payout. You'll often encounter odds presented in three standard formats: Decimal, Fractional, and American. Decimal odds, prevalent in Europe, demonstrate the total return for every pound risked . Fractional odds, standard in the UK, indicate the ratio of profit compared the stake. Finally, American odds, often employed in the US, can be plus (indicating how much you'd gain on a $100 stake) or minus (indicating how much you'd need stake to win $100). Learning these differences is vital to making smart betting choices .
